i've been running vista ultimate on my p4 2.6 ghz (which i bought in late 2004) since february and i haven't faced any great problems so far.There were the odd crashes from time to time during the first two months but after the first bunch of updates it was all fine.i've never had any performance issues either runs pretty smooth.I had to upgrade a few hardware components though when i bought vista.I upgraded my ram to 1gb and got a dx10 compatiable nvidia 6200.I think if you have a config equal to or better than this then vista is very much worth the upgrade!
